Sight Sciences (SGHT), a medical device company focused on surgical and interventional glaucoma therapies, has released its first quarter 2026 financial results. The company posted a net loss per share of $0.24, representing a continued commitment to its strategic investments in expanding its product portfolio within the ophthalmic surgical device market. Management Commentary

Leadership at Sight Sciences emphasized the company's dedication to advancing its surgical platform technologies during the quarter. The management team has consistently highlighted the growing adoption of MIGS procedures as a preferred treatment approach for glaucoma patients seeking reduced reliance on topical medications. In previous communications, company executives have noted the importance of physician education and surgical training programs in driving market penetration. This quarter likely saw continued investment in these initiatives, which the company views as essential to long-term revenue growth. The medical device industry often requires sustained educational outreach to healthcare providers, and Sight Sciences has structured its operations accordingly. The company's focus on its OMNI Surgical System and Tears Scientia surgical platform remains central to its value proposition. These products target the significant unmet need in glaucoma management, where millions of patients worldwide continue to experience disease progression despite available treatment options.
